A Beenleigh woman couldn’t believe her eyes when she scratched a $150,000 top prize win on an Instant Scratch-Its ticket, admitting she almost spilt her cup of tea over in the heat of the moment.

The Queenslander purchased her top prize winning $10 Jumbo Crosswords Instant Scratch-Its ticket at Beenleigh Marketplace Newsextra, Shop 29A, Beenleigh Market Place, Beenleigh.

The winning woman was still reeling from the instant win while on the phone to lottery officials despite claiming the prize at The Lott headquarters days prior.

“I thought it was a joke at first,” she laughed.

“It’s so exciting. I was at the local newsagency at Beenleigh Marketplace, and I thought I’d buy a couple of the Crossword scratchies because they’re my favourite.

“I just enjoy scratching them and I never expect to win anything big.

“I had sat down to enjoy a cuppa and my scratchies.

“Lo and behold, $150,000 came up. I seriously thought someone was playing a trick on me and I nearly spilt my tea.

“I went straight back to the newsagency and the team member told me I’d have to claim it at The Lott head office. That’s when I knew it was real.

“I’m just letting it sink in. No celebrations as of yet!

“I’d love to fix my car. It has a few mechanical faults.

“But for now, I’ll sit on the win and process it all.”

In 2023, there were 144 Instant Scratch-Its top prize winners across The Lott’s jurisdictions who collectively took home more than $12.1 million in top prizes.

During this same time, Instant Scratch-Its players enjoyed more than 26.76 million wins across all prize tiers worth more than $249.17 million. This equates to more than half a million winners a week and about $700,000 won on Instant Scratch-Its every day.
